GCN Circular 15326

Subject
Fermi403206457: Weihai optical upper limit
Date
2013-10-13T05:42:47Z (11 years ago)
From
Dong Xu at DARK/NBI <dong.dark@gmail.com>
D. Xu (DARK/NBI), C.-M. Zhang, C. Cao, S.-M. Hu (SDU) report:

We observed the location of the candidate optical afterglow
(iPTF13dsw; Kasliwal et al., GCN 15324) of the Fermi-GBM trigger
403206457 with the 1m telescope located in Weihai, Shandong, China. We
obtained 5x600s R-band frames at a mean time of 2013-10-12 18:01:29 UT
(i.e., 24.23 hr after the Fermi-GBM trigger) under some clouds.

No optical source is detected at the iPTF location in the stacked
image down to a limiting magnitude of R > ~20.0 mag, calibrated with
the nearby SDSS field.
